由於有個項目是大數據類型的,需要時時展現數據,這就出現了這個需求,頁面不斷刷新,這個其實很簡單了,window.location.reload();
這個就輕松搞定了,但是靈機一動,加上個控制吧,這下問題就來了,以前刷新的是整個頁面的數據,但是點擊刷新后
重新加載了,就不能自動刷新了,定時器不起作用了,瞬間很蛋疼了,仔細一想,還是刷新iframe吧 ,這下就輕松了好多,
var numCount = 0;
$(".shuaxin").on("click",function(){
if(numCount%2 == 0){
obj = window.setInterval("window.frames['frameid'].location.reload()",1200000);
$(".shuaxin>span").text("取消刷新")
}else{
clearInterval(obj);
$(".shuaxin>span").text("定時刷新")
}
numCount++;
})
把window變換成iframe的屬性就好了,這里我換成了iframe的name值,瞬間感覺良好。。。
還可以進入個人博客:www.jishubar.cn
